Output b39fc1d89f55b7b1af15ba8f2c4b5d48e2d2c900fa1a2820efbfa085a9d31008:6

value
69120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780bca96e451d9119b69db3e735ab2892e6c65a3 OP_EQUAL
address
3Cdm8qn5Ndz6egoqeGk46DQUnbdzAzSKQW
transaction
b39fc1d89f55b7b1af15ba8f2c4b5d48e2d2c900fa1a2820efbfa085a9d31008
confirmations
454054
spent
true